Cloud EV’s MG Version Likely To Be Called Windsor

MG Motor is gearing up to launch a new EV for the Indian market that will be based on the Wuling Cloud EV sold globally. A recent trademark filing from MG has confirmed that it is likely to be called the “Windsor EV’ in the Indian market. MG will officially reveal the CUV’s name on August 5.

MG Windsor EV – Expected Battery Pack and Range

Globally, the Wuling Cloud EV has two battery pack options: a 37.9kWh pack with a 360km range and a 50.6kWh pack with a 460km range. It comes equipped with a front-axle mounted permanent magnet synchronous (PMS) motor developing a max power output of 134PS. However, it is yet to be seen which battery pack will be offered in its Indian version.

Design and Features

Based on the teaser, the upcoming MG CUV clearly resembles the Cloud EV, which is known for its sleek and modern curvy design. The teaser reveals full-width LED light bars at the front, giving the vehicle a distinctive and striking look. It also confirms the presence of fully reclinable front seats, known as “SOFA MODE,” offering a 135-degree backseat recline for enhanced comfort.

Expected Price and Rivals

MG is likely to price the Cloud EV under Rs 20 lakh in India, positioning it between the Air EV and ZS EV in their lineup. This pricing would place it in direct competition with the Tata Nexon EV and Mahindra XUV400.
